This is normally caused by mod_ssl not being able to load the libeay32.dll and/or ssleay32.dll.
If you downloaded the latest OPEN-SSL tool then copy these 2 dll's from the OPEN_SSL folder you installed that into, and put them in the \wamp\bin\php\php{version} folder.
Do this for all versions of PHP that you have installed into WAMPServer.
Then using the wampmanager menus do this to make sure the correct SYMLINKS are created to these new dll's
(right click)wampmanager icon -> Refresh
Now start/restart Apache using
(left click) wampmanager -> Apache -> Service Administration -> Restart service
And all should be well
